Types of Non-Lethal Weapons

Understanding the various types of non-lethal weapons is essential for anyone considering personal defense options. These tools can enhance your self-defense techniques and improve situational awareness. Here are three popular types:
  1. Pepper Spray: This incapacitating agent causes temporary blindness and respiratory distress, allowing you to escape. Products like Wildfire Pepper Gel are particularly effective.
  2. Stun Guns: Delivering high-voltage shocks (up to 100 million volts), stun guns can immobilize an attacker temporarily, providing you with a vital opportunity to flee.
  3. Personal Alarms: Emitting sounds up to 120 decibels, these devices attract attention and deter threats when activated.
Additionally, many pepper sprays, such as the Mace Pepper Gel Night Defender MK-III, utilize a built-in LED light to improve visibility in low-light environments. These non-lethal options offer practical means to enhance your safety without inflicting permanent harm.

Types of Personal Alarms

When seeking effective methods for enhancing personal safety, understanding the various types of personal alarms available is essential. These devices vary in features and functionality, impacting their emergency response effectiveness. Here are three common types:
  1. Standard Personal Alarms: Emit a loud sound, typically around 120 decibels, to deter attackers and attract attention.
  2. LED Light Alarms: Include built-in LED lights to improve visibility in low-light situations, enhancing personal safety.
  3. Pull Pin Models: Activate the alarm when separated from their holder, providing a quick alert mechanism in emergencies.

Local Regulations Overview

Understanding local regulations regarding non-lethal weapons is vital for anyone pondering their use for self-defense. The legality of these weapons varies widely due to state differences, making it imperative to be informed. Here are three key points to reflect on:
  1. Age and Purchase Requirements: Some states mandate individuals to be at least 18 years old and may require background checks for purchases.
  2. Local Prohibitions: Certain municipalities may entirely prohibit specific non-lethal weapons, like stun guns or high-capacity pepper spray.
  3. Legal Consequences: Even when legal, using these weapons can lead to criminal charges if deemed excessive or inappropriate.
Always verify local regulations to confirm compliance and understand the implications of using non-lethal weapons in self-defense situations.

Tips for Safe Usage

Understanding how to safely use non-lethal weapons is essential for maximizing their effectiveness in self-defense scenarios. By following these guidelines, you can guarantee a responsible approach:
  1. Read Instructions: Always read the manufacturer’s instructions carefully to understand proper handling and usage.
  2. Practice Scenarios: Regularly practice using your self-defense tools in a safe environment to build familiarity and confidence.
  3. Safe Storage: Keep your non-lethal weapons easily accessible yet concealed to allow quick access without drawing unnecessary attention.
Additionally, maintain your items by checking for battery life in stun guns and verifying that pepper spray hasn’t expired. Finally, stay informed about local legal regulations regarding non-lethal weapons to guarantee compliance and avoid potential legal issues. How Should I Maintain My Non-Lethal Weapon?

Imagine your trusty tool, ready to assist you in times of need. To keep it effective, apply proper cleaning techniques—use a soft cloth to wipe away dirt and avoid harsh chemicals. Storage tips are essential, too; keep it in a cool, dry place to prevent damage. Regularly check expiration dates or battery life, ensuring peak performance. Familiarizing yourself with its operation will prepare you for any eventuality, maintaining your tool’s reliability.

What Should I Do After Using a Non-Lethal Weapon?

After using a non-lethal weapon, you need to prioritize your safety by moving to a secure location. It’s essential to contact law enforcement to report the incident, addressing any legal considerations involved. You should also seek medical attention if needed, as injuries may not be immediately apparent. Document the incident thoroughly, noting the emotional aftermath and any physical evidence, to support your account and protect yourself legally in potential future proceedings.
